In-Transit Merge
The process of combining different shipments en route, typically at a hub, to improve transportation efficiency and reduce costs.
Drop-Shipping
A retail fulfillment method where a store doesn’t keep the products it sells in stock. Instead, when a store sells a product, it purchases the item from a third party and has it shipped directly to the customer.
Manufacturer/Distributor Storage
Facilities used by manufacturers or distributors for the warehousing of products before they are distributed to retailers or customers.
Customer Experience
The overall perception and satisfaction a customer has with a business or brand, based on interactions across all touchpoints.
